I put my girlfriend on my deed to my house after i bought it. we are no longer in a relationship and she won't leave.
John's answer
|
Answered on June 22, 2013
You can force a sale of the house and then each owner can go their own way. But one owner can't simply remove another owner on a whim.

Archived
Can a bonding company still take money from me if i'm on disability? the person didn't show for court.
John's answer
|
Answered on June 22, 2013
Of course they can. Just because you get a check from the government doesn't mean you can't be sued for breaching a contract that you signed.
